  • Patent number: 4766506
    Abstract: A television synchronizing signal processing circuit includes a reproduction/demodulation circuit for repetitively reading a video signal corresponding to one field from a video signal recording medium and demodulating the video signal and for separating a synchronizing signal from a reproduced/demodulated signal, a first delay circuit for permitting the video signal of the reproduced/demodulated signal which is supplied for every other field from the reproduction/demodulation circuit to be delayed by a time corresponding to one half the period H of a horizontal synchronizing signal, a second delay circuit for delaying a vertical synchronizing signal of the synchronizing signal which is supplied from the reproduction/demodulation circuit, and a waveform synthesizing circuit for synthesizing output signals from the first and second delay circuits to produce a composite video signal. In the processing circuit, the second delay circuit has a variable time TD which is variable within a range of0<TD<H/2.

  • Patent number: 4680631
    Abstract: A television composite video signal processing circuit has a readout circuit for repeatedly reading out a one-field composite video signal from a disk memory. A delay circuit delays the composite video signal from the readout circuit by 1/2 of a horizontal sync signal period H, and a pedestal clamping circuit sets the pedestal levels of the composite video signals from the delay circuit and the readout circuit to a predetermined level. A signal selector alternately supplies the composite video signals from the readout circuit and the delay circuit to the pedestal clamping circuit for every other field, and a peak level correction circuit corrects the peak level of the delayed video signal in the delayed composite video signal from the delay circuit.

  • Patent number: 4675751
    Abstract: A television synchronization signal processing circuit includes a reproduction/demodulation circuit for reproducing a video signal by repeatedly reading out a video signal for one field from a video signal recording medium, generating the reproduced video signal and a synchronization signal separated from the reproduced video signal, a first delay circuit for delaying the reproduced video signal read out for every other field from the reproduction/demodulation circuit by one half a period of the horizontal synchronization signal, signal transmitting circuit for transmitting a vertical synchronization signal included in the separated synchronization signal from the reproduction/demodulation circuit, and waveform synthesis circuit for synthesizing output signals from the first delay circuit and signal transmitting circuit to produce a composite video signal used for effecting video display.

  • Patent number: 4570211
    Abstract: A power supply circuit for driving a motor includes a rectifier circuit and a converter circuit for stepping down the DC voltage from the rectifier circuit to drive a motor. The power supply circuit further includes a regulator circuit which is energized by the DC output voltage from the converter circuit to supply a constant voltage or current to the motor.
